A Low Complexity Cell Search Method For Ieee 802.16e Ofdma Systems

摘要
In broadband wireless access, it is very important for the mobile station to perform initial synchronization and cell search when setting up the downlink transmission. The IEEE 802.16e OFDMA system is different from conventional OFDM systems such as WLAN. Its time-domain preamble does not have perfect periodicity for time synchronization. Also, the complexity of the conventional Cell ID identification method is very high due to its large number of long preamble Pseudo-Noise codes. In this paper, the property of the frequency-domain preamble and that of an OFDM signal are used to achieve frame detection and Cell ID identification. Meanwhile, the integer and fractional frequency offsets are estimated to accomplish frequency synchronization. The proposed method can effectively reduce the complexity in Cell ID identification and improve the frame detection accuracy.
